输入支援装置、输入支援方法以及程序的制作方法_2

文档序号:9438837阅读:来源:国知局
大、或使标记的初始形状下的隔离范围显示得比规定部位大,因此取得如下这样的效果:即使在与显示器接近几厘米程度进行操作等情况下,也不会由于利用者自身的指头、手等而将操作对象物隐藏,能够提高操作性。
[0032]此外,根据本发明,由于空间坐标相对于规定面的距离是相对于规定面而言利用者所处一侧的空间坐标的距离,因此取得如下这样的效果:从利用者侧越接近于规定面,就使多个形状彼此越接近于显示画面的相对应的位置,并在越过了规定面的情况下,能够判定为点击等的选择状态。
[0033]此外,根据本发明,空间坐标是由与显示画面平行的规定面的二维坐标、以及与规定面垂直的进深坐标构成的三维坐标,使标记的中心移动到被更新的二维坐标的对应于显示画面的位置,并且被更新的进深坐标相对于规定面越接近于O,使从中心隔离开的多个形状彼此越接近而作为一个连续的形状来显示。由此,能够提供快速且直观地提供在几厘米的近距离到几米的远距离下都能够使用的适当的输入操作的反馈。
【附图说明】
[0034]图1是表示作为现有例的悬停按钮即时按下方式的一个例子的图。
[0035]图2是表示作为现有例的悬停按钮一定时间经过后按下方式的一个例子的图。
[0036]图3是表不作为现有例的下压按钮光标着色方式的一个例子的图。
[0037]图4是表示应用本实施方式的输入支援装置100的构成的一个例子的框图。
[0038]图5是表示将本实施方式应用于几cm程度的近距离的非接触操作的情况下的、显示部114的显示器、空中虚拟触摸面板以及利用者的位置关系的图。
[0039]图6是表示将本实施方式应用于几米程度的远距离非接触操作的情况下的、显示部114的显示器、空中虚拟触摸面板以及利用者的位置关系的图。
[0040]图7是表示将本实施方式应用于头戴式显示器的非接触操作的情况下的、显示部114的显示器、空中虚拟触摸面板以及利用者的位置关系的图。
[0041]图8是表示本实施方式中的输入支援装置100的输入支援处理的一个例子的流程图。
[0042]图9是示意性地表示本实施方式的下压按钮标记方式的图。
[0043]图10是示意性地表示本实施方式的滑动标记方式的图。
[0044]图11是示意性地表示本实施方式的缩放标记方式的图。
【具体实施方式】
[0045]以下,基于附图来对本发明所涉及的输入支援装置、输入支援方法、程序以及记录介质的实施方式详细进行说明。另外,本发明并不限定于这些实施方式。
[0046][本实施方式的概要]
[0047]以下,关于本发明所涉及的本实施方式的概要,一边与现有方式进行比较一边进行说明,然后,对本实施方式的构成以及处理等详细进行说明。另外,并非通过本概要的说明来限定以后说明的本实施方式的构成以及处理。
[0048]在现有技术中,使用Kinect(R)传感器(微软公司制)、Leap传感器(Leap Mot1n社制)等检测单元,不使用远程控制器,用手或指头以非接触的方式可远程操作计算机等的技术开发和商品开发正在推进。
[0049]若使用这些检测单元,则能够读取利用者的手或指头的三维空间坐标,因此存在想要实现使用了利用者的手或指头作为定点设备的代替的用户接口的尝试。在此,以下参照图1?图3对现有的非接触下的按钮按下方式的示例进行说明。在此,图1是表示作为现有例的悬停按钮即时按下方式的一个例子的图。图中的矩形是显示画面,在显示画面中作为按下对象的一个例子而显示有按钮,箭头的左侧表示移动前,箭头的右侧表示移动后(以下也同样)。
[0050]如图1所示,现有的悬停按钮即时按下方式,是若利用者使指头(或与指头联动的光标)移动(悬停)到想要按下的对象上,则立即按下按钮的方式(MA-1?2)。作为悬停按钮即时按下方式的特征,虽然具有没有到按下为止的等待时间这样的优点,但是具有如下这样的缺点:由于进行误操作的可能性,因而不适于倘若误操作便会导致危险的操作,并且若在画面上不显示光标则难以知晓按下对象。在此,图2是作为现有例的悬停按钮一定时间经过后按下方式的一个例子的图。
[0051]如图2所示,现有的悬停按钮一定时间经过后按下方式,是若利用者使指头(或与指头联动的光标)移动(悬停)到想要按下的对象上(MB-1),则在该例中以指头(或与指头联动的光标)为中心花费一定时间沿顺时针方向画圆(MB-2),若经过一定时间则按下对象的方式(MB-3)。作为悬停按钮一定时间经过后按下方式的特征,由于一定时间内没有被按下,因此直到按下决定为止利用者有可能注意到错误,具有能够抑制误操作这样的优点,但是具有为了进行按下动作而需要一定时间这样的缺点。在此,图3是表示作为现有例的下压按钮光标着色方式的一个例子的图。
[0052]如图3所示,现有的下压按钮光标着色方式,是在按下对象与指头的距离较远的情况下,光标显示为白色(MC-1),若利用者使指头接近按下对象,则根据该距离使光标的颜色变化(MC-2?MC-4),若指头达到一定距离以内则按下对象的方式(MC-5)。作为下压按钮光标着色方式的特征,具有能够立即按下对象并且由于直到按下对象为止有向利用者的反馈因而能够抑制误操作这样的优点,但是具有如下这样的缺点:在以几厘米的距离使用等情况下,若利用者的手或指头位于利用者的眼睛与光标之间,则难以看见光标。
[0053]本申请发明人鉴于上述的问题点等,经过了潜心研究,结果完成了本申请发明。本申请发明的实施方式具有如下特征。
[0054]S卩,本实施方式经由检测部,连续地获取关于利用者的规定部位(手、指头、掌、脚等)的空间坐标。作为一个例子,空间坐标可以是由与显示画面平行的规定面的二维坐标(X坐标、y坐标)、以及与规定面垂直的进深坐标(z坐标)构成的三维坐标(X,y,z)。
[0055]然后,本实施方式进行基于被更新的空间坐标,使标记移动到显示部的显示画面的相对应的位置的显示控制。优选地,本实施方式可以使标记显示得比规定部位大、或使标记的初始形状下的隔离范围显示得比规定部位大。另外,本实施方式也可以在显示控制中,与标记分开进行基于被更新的空间坐标来在显示画面的相对应的位置还显示光标的控制。
[0056]在此,标记的初始形状是将任意的形状(例如圆环、同心圆环(donut)形状等)进行了分割的多个形状。本实施方式在上述的显示控制中,进行如下的显示控制:空间坐标的坐标系中空间坐标相对于规定面的距离(利用者所处一侧到规定面的距离等)越大,从显示画面的相对应的位置使多个形状彼此隔离越远,另一方面,该距离越小,使多个形状彼此越接近于显示画面的相对应的位置。
[0057]另外,规定面可以是与显示画面相对应的形状(例如矩形形状)的、与显示画面平行的面。在本实施方式中,实现作为空间坐标系中的虚拟的触摸面板(以下有时称作“空中虚拟触摸面板”)的作用。即,在利用者好像在空中有触摸面板那样进行操作的情况下,本实施方式进行改善视觉反馈的适当的输入支援。
[0058]随后,本实施方式可以在被更新的空间坐标通过了规定面的状态下(从利用者所处一侧移动到了规定面的相反一侧的情况等),判定为按下状态。按下对象既可以是位于标记的中心的对象,也可以是光标所在的对象。
[0059]如上所述,根据本实施方式,具有如下这样的优点:除了能够立即将按下对象按下的优点以外,还由于直到按下对象为止才向利用者有适当的反馈因而能够防止误操作。此夕卜,即使在几厘米的距离下使用,也能够在指头等的周围显示标记,因而具有看不见标记而不能操作的可能性低的优点。因此,能够克服现有例的问题点,有助于操作性的大幅度提尚O
[0060]以上,结束本发明的本实施方式的概要的说明。接下来,以下详细说明本实施方式的构成以及处理等。
[0061 ][输入支援装置100的构成]
[0062]首先,对本实施方式所涉及的输入支援装置100的构成进行说明。图4是表示应用本实施方式的输入支援装置100的构成的一个例子的框图,仅概念性地示出了该构成中与本实施方式有关的部分。
[0063]图4中输入支援装置100简要构成为具备统一控制整个输入支援装置100的CPU等控制部102、与连接于通信线路等的路由器等通信装置(未图示)连接的通信控制接口部104、与检测部112、显示部114等连接的输入输出控制接口部108、以及保存各种数据库、表等的存储部106,这些各部经由任意的通信路径可通信地连接。
[0064]存储部106中保存的各种数据库、表(显示要素文件106a等)是固定磁盘装置等的存储单元,保存用于各种处理的各种程序、表、文件、数据库、网页等。
[0065]这些存储部106的各构成要素中,显示要素文件106a是存储能够作为显示画面的显示要素来显示的数据的要素数据存储单元。例如,显示要素文件106a可以存储图标等GUI按钮、文字、记号、图形、成为立体对象等对象的数据。另外,成为这些
当前第2页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1